2024-03-12 — Key rotation for Carthold migration. As part of replacing our homegrown job queue with Spindleworks, the worker fleet now pulls signed task definitions from the new broker. The old queue's signing key was retired on this date and must not be reused anywhere. All workers should verify payloads against the replacement key below.

deploy key for fafof-kafop: bky6_8ADxhw

Postmortem action item for the Darrowmere release: cold starts on the Veyland serverless handlers caused a nine-minute latency spike after the canary rollout, because the pre-warm pool was drained during the deploy window. The release manager should ensure future rollouts stagger handler replacement and keep a minimum warm reserve throughout. We have also shortened the initialization timeout so stuck handlers recycle faster, and added a dashboard alert on warm-pool depletion. The agreed tuning constants for the next release are below.

limits module of bageg-bahof:
RATE_LIMITS = {
    "druwyn": 10,
    "oliael": 10,
    "holwyn": 1,
    "wenath": 1,
}

## Capacity Note: SQL Lint Pipeline

Heads up for whoever inherits this: the Brambleline SQL linter chews through every .sql file on each merge, and our repo count keeps growing. At current growth we'll saturate the lint workers by next quarter unless we raise the parallelism caps or shard by directory. The parser cache helps a lot, so don't disable it without re-benchmarking. Most of the knobs live in one config block, and they're worth revisiting quarterly. The values we settled on after the last load test are below.

tuning table, yajog-yahof:
BUDGETS = {
    "lamvan": 303,
    "wenox": 460,
    "fenvan": 525,
}